Faircloth, C. J.:

The exceptions to the evidence were waived in this Court and the argument was made mainly on the division of the costs. Each party claimed .title to, and the plaintiff recovered a part of, the land. The jury failed to answer the issue as to the damages on a part of the land, which was left over by the court to be decided hereafter. In this fragmentary condition, we are not disposed to disturb the judgment on the question of costs.

Judgment Affirmed.
